TipTopJob is looking for a talented Personal Injury Solicitor with a minimum of 2 years' PQE to join their growing department in Cheshire. This role offers the chance to manage your own caseload of personal injury claims while being part of an established litigation team committed to quality.
The successful candidate will benefit from a supportive culture with ample progression opportunities. The firm is recognized for its client relationships and exceptional legal services, providing a collaborative work environment and competitive salary.

How to prepare for a job interview at TipTopJob
✨Know Your Stuff
Make sure you brush up on personal injury law and recent case studies. Being able to discuss relevant cases or changes in legislation will show that you're not just qualified, but genuinely interested in the field.
✨Showcase Your Experience
Prepare to talk about your previous caseloads and how you've managed them. Highlight specific successes and challenges you've faced, as this will demonstrate your ability to handle the responsibilities of the role.
✨Understand the Firm's Culture
Research TipTopJob’s values and their approach to client relationships. Be ready to explain how your personal values align with theirs, as cultural fit is often just as important as qualifications.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ions about the team dynamics, progression opportunities, and the types of cases you might handle. This shows your enthusiasm for the role and helps you gauge if it’s the right fit for you.
